To make a timeless sangria, you will need:

-1 bottle of wine
-1 cup of brandy
-1/ 2 cup of triple sec
-1 cup of orange juice
-1 cup of lemonade
-1/ 2 cup of sugar
-1 orange, sliced
-1 lemon, sliced up
-1 lime, sliced
-1/ 2 cup of grapes

Guidelines:

1. In a large pitcher, integrate the white wine, brandy, triple sec, orange juice, lemonade, and sugar.

2. Include the orange, lemon, lime, and grapes.

3. Stir up until the sugar is liquified.

4. Refrigerate for a minimum of 1 hour, or over night.

5. Serve over ice.

How long does sangria last?


Assuming you're speaking about homemade sangria, it will last about 3-4 days in the refrigerator. If you're talking about store-bought sangria, it will last about 2 weeks in the refrigerator.


How do you make a sparkling sangria?


A sparkling sangria is a revitalizing and joyful  beverage that is perfect for summer season entertaining. The secret to making a great gleaming sangria is to start with a good quality champagne. Prosecco or Cava are both exceptional options. For the fruit, use a mix of fresh seasonal berries and citrus fruits. Include a splash of brandy or triple sec for a little extra depth of flavor. And finally, make certain to chill the sangria for at least an hour prior to serving to allow the flavors to blend.
